The present invention provides a solar cell packaging board and a solar cell module using the same, which are excellent in adhesion strength, storage stability, productivity, and environmental resistance of the packaging sheet and the packaging material for a solar cell.nThe present invention relates to a solar battery back sheet having only one base film and a C layer, the C layer having an acrylic resin as a main component, the base film having an A layer and a B layer, the A layer being The polyester resin is a main component, and the A layer contains 5.0% by mass or more and 25% by mass or less of a white pigment, and has a thickness of 5 μm or more, and is disposed on the outermost surface of the other side of the back sheet, and the B layer is mainly composed of a polyester resin. In the component, all of the components of the layer B contain 1.0% by mass or more and less than 5.0% by mass of the white pigment, and the thickness is 70% or more of the entire back sheet. Still another invention is a solar cell backsheet wherein the C layer is obtained from a composition having a reactive functional group acrylic resin and a protected isocyanate compound and an unprotected isocyanate compound. |
